Maxbauer Arraigned On Drunk Driving Charge

July 29, 2016

Grand Traverse County Commission Chair Christine Maxbauer was arraigned on a drunk driving charge Thursday in 86th District Court.

Maxbauer appeared before Judge Audrey Van Alst, a special appointee to the case from the 84th District Court. Grand Traverse County's judges and County Prosecuting Attorney Bob Cooney recused themselves from the proceedings because of Maxbauer's involvement in county government. Leelanau County Prosecutor Joseph Hubbell was appointed to the case in Cooney's stead.

Maxbauer stood mute on the witness stand during the arraigment, prompting the court to enter a not guilty plea on her behalf. Maxbauer is facing a drunken driving charge stemming from a July 7 incident in which she crashed into a parked car on West Front Street and blew a .16 BAC.

A pretrial date has not yet been set in the case.
